About this course

Literature is diverse. Understanding a range of values and beliefs can open new worlds. Every text we pick up gives us a different perspective on humankind and our shared experiences. By combining English Literature with Philosophy and Ethics, you’ll deepen your understanding of how these perspectives can be shaped by different beliefs and values.
